Docker - 6. Jupyter notebook 사용 & KoBERT 사용해보기
📌 작성내용
- 환경 : Pytorch
- 목적 : KoBERT 실행 환경 구축
📕 과정
1. docker 이미지 다운
- pytorch image 필요
- docker search pytorch로 pytorch 이미지명 찾기
docker pull pytorch/pytorch
2. 컨테이너 생성
docker run -it -d --gpus all --name pytorch_nlp -p 8888:8888 pytorch/pytorch /bin/bash
3. 컨테이너 실행
- `docker exec -it pytorch_nlp /bin/bash
4. GIT 설치
apt-get update
얘를 실행해줘야 다음 설치과정이 진행가능
apt-get install git
5. KoBERT 들고오기
pip install 'git+https://github.com/SKTBrain/KoBERT.git#egg=kobert_tokenizer&subdirectory=kobert_hf'
- 링크
6. 그 외 몇개 설치
pip install transformers
pip install sentencepiece
7. Jupyter Notebook 설치
pip install jupyter-notebook
pip install ipykernel
python -m ipykernel install --user --name=pytorch_nlp
8. 주피터노트북 켜기
jupyter notebook --ip='0.0.0.0' --port=8888 --allow-root
9. 파일 생성
- 생성했던 ipykernel 로 주피터파일 생성
10.테스트